Rohit KhubchandaniRohit Khubchandani
Arsalan Restaurant in Karama is a true gem for lovers of Kolkata-style biryani and Mughlai cuisine. If you’re seeking authentic flavors that transport you straight to the City of Joy, this is the place to be. We tried their Mutton Biryani, and it was absolutely outstanding. The biryani had the perfect balance of flavors and spices, with fragrant saffron, tender pieces of lamb, and the signature Kolkata touch—soft, flavorful potatoes that add a unique twist to this classic dish. Every bite was a nostalgic reminder of the authentic Mughlai culinary heritage that Arsalan has been serving since 2002. The menu also boasts a range of Mughlai dishes, from tandoors to kebabs and buttery naan, ensuring there’s something for every food lover. The ambiance in the Karama branch is simple yet warm, making it a great spot for families and friends to enjoy hearty, flavorful meals. Arsalan brings the best of Kolkata’s culinary magic to Dubai, and it’s a must-visit for anyone craving authentic biryani or Mughlai cuisine. Highly recommended for a trip down memory lane or to discover the irresistible charm of Kolkata’s food culture!

Priyanjana KumarPriyanjana Kumar
The food is priced at a reasonable rate. The staff are very helpful most are Bengalis. However, the food is quite oily with practically oil dripping into the plate. (On request if less oil can be used it would benefit the customers especially because many people can have dietary restrictions) Although, the specialty of the restaurant itself is the biryani. But, in my opinion, the biryani can be made in less oily and could be more textured as for an authentic biryani dish it is very dry and can feel a little hard to digest at times. The mutton roll is amazing! It’s perfectly melting into your mouth leaving you with a long lasting taste of flavour.

There was a point of time just few years back when I had biryani at Arsalan dubai and was like - that’s even better than what we get in Kolkata. But alas probably it was like beetlejuice, we praised it too many times and now it has come to a point where I had to throw almost the entire packet of biryani, chaap down the bin just yesterday.

The standard of Arsalan dubai has drastically gone down in terms of food, service and behavior of staff. In restaurant staff behavior especially at the counter has changed so much to the point you wouldn’t want to even talk to them. For delivery they keep making false statements and after reminders and calls we get food having to wait for 2-3hrs, and mind you this has been the case every-time we have been ordering, be it morning afternoon evening or night, weekday or weekend. These are in-spite of the fact that I have been ordering from them for like twice every week.

Now coming to the food, it’s pretty clear they have downgraded the quality of raw materials along with their cooking. Now it’s dalda instead of ghee in all the items and the mutton quality is nothing close to edible. I waited for a long time giving them multiple tries with various items before being compelled to write this review after my experience from last night’s order. The biryani smelled horrible, the meat quality was pathetic, and today I fell ill as well.

It’s sad to see the only restaurant serving your favorite dish going down like this. I really hope Arsalan can bring back the old self, but till then I don’t think I will be...
